1. Field of the Invention
The present invention relates to a riveting kit, and more particularly to a riveting kit that enables to achieve a DIY (Do It Yourself) combination of an eyelet.
2. Description of Related Art
Generally, an eyelet is attached to cloth, leather or belt for decoration or to permit the attachment of cords or lines for convenient fastening.
However, the attachment of the eyelet has to be achieved by skilled craftsman so that person without training can not achieve the attachment of the eyelet by self and manufacturing cost greatly increases. Because it is hard to find a craftsman now, wage of the craftsman is correspondingly high. Additionally, the craftsman may not want to accept the job of eyelet since the job is getting rare.
According to above description, the conventional way to attach the eyelet can not be done by non-skilled craftsmen so that clothing designers or homemaker hardly uses the eyelet themselves.
A main objective of the present invention is to provide a riveting kit for an eyelet that enables a non-skilled to achieve an eyelet attachment by self.
To achieve the foregoing objective, the riveting kit for an eyelet comprises:
a molding base having a pedestal with a top face, a positioning shaft erecting on the top face of the pedestal, an annular groove defined around the positioning shaft on the top face of the pedestal, wherein the positioning shaft has a distal end and is tapered to the distal end; and
a pressing shaft operationally engaging the positioning shaft and having a recess accommodating the positioning shaft and a shallow annular groove defined on the pressing shaft around the recess;
wherein, the eyelet is clamped between the molding base and the pressing shaft when an attachment of the eyelet is performed.
By simply pushing the pressing shaft to the molding base, the eyelet is deformed at edges to secure on a cloth piece or leather in a convenient way so that users without training still can do the attachment of the eyelet by themselves.

A riveting kit for an eyelet in accordance with the present invention comprises a molding base and a pressing shaft. The molding base has a top face, a positioning shaft erecting on the molding base and an annular groove defined on the top face around the positioning shaft. The positioning shaft has a tapered end to penetrate a cloth piece and the eyelet until the eyelet rests on the molding base. The pressing shaft presses the eyelet to deform edges of the eyelet within the annular groove so that the eyelet is firmly fixed on the cloth piece. Thereby, attachment of the eyelet is easily, rapidly and conveniently achieved.
